Output efc8eb2c24a4e12a7e8739ab38aad4ec70f8140ff12067943dab6c155b74a4a9:193

value
142260
script pubkey
OP_0 OP_PUSHBYTES_32 e6d98225bf78221c631b6f436d8c219692960e1c3f6c5f00523ac4c0ca9a0e2d
address
bc1qumvcyfdl0q3pcccmdapkmrppj6ffvrsu8ak97qzj8tzvpj56pcks0r8tj6
transaction
efc8eb2c24a4e12a7e8739ab38aad4ec70f8140ff12067943dab6c155b74a4a9
confirmations
123012
spent
true